Perfect for softening harsh lines, fluffy blending brushes are typically the last step to complete your eye look. These brushes can also be great to blend transition colors or diffuse a bold shade, ensuring that your eye makeup has that beautiful diffused finish. The Best Eyeshadow Brushes I Can't Live Without Highlight the inner corner with a white or champagne shimmer to make the eyes appear more open. Wing liner slightly past the lash line to lift the eye. Use a medium shade, neutral flat shadow blending up past the hooded lid to make the hooded lid appear not so hooded. Curl your lashes and load them up with mascara to make the eyes look bigger.

Refine By Eyeshadow Crease Brushes: On mature people, the eyelid skin is looser and can start to sag forward (especially on those with hooded eyes) so it’s important to create the illusion of the skin receding so it looks less saggy. To do that I use a soft fluffy crease brush with an eyeshadow that’s 1-2 shades darker than my natural skin tone. Two of my faves are:
